Kyrgyzstan - Undernourished Population
Since 2014, Kyrgyzstan Undernourished Population was down by 1.2% year on year. With 376,223 Persons in 2019, the country was number 78 among other countries in Undernourished Population. Kyrgyzstan is overtaken by Chile, which was ranked number 77 with 477,885 Persons and is followed by Panama at 364,463 Persons. India topped the ranking with 191,384,535.93 Persons in 2019, that is -1% compared to 2018. China, Pakistan and Nigeria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Venezuela recorded the best 5 years average growth at +19.7% per year, while Colombia was the worst growing country at -9.5% per year.
